The cheapest way to get from Bremen to Harlesiel is to drive which costs €17 - €26 and takes 1h 20m.
The fastest way to get from Bremen to Harlesiel is to drive which takes 1h 20m and costs €17 - €26.
Yes, there is a direct bus departing from Bremen Hauptbahnhof Fernbusterminal and arriving at Harlesiel Anleger. Services depart four times a day, and operate every day. The journey takes approximately 2h 35m.
The distance between Bremen and Harlesiel is 153 km. The road distance is 123.9 km.
